Low Fat Faux Chicken Fried Steak
- Ready In:
- 25mins
- Ingredients:
- 4
- Serves:
-
4
ingredients
- 4 ground turkey breast, patties
- 1⁄2 cup seasoned bread crumbs (Shake n' Bake)
- 1 ounce gravy mix (Country Style is 35 cal. per serving)
- 1 cup water
directions
- Set oven to 350 degrees.
- Lightly spray oil a cookie sheet.
- Pour Shake n' Bake on a plate.
- Rinse turkey breast patties to moisten.
- Lay patties on Shake n' Bake, then turn to coat.
- Place coated patties on cookie sheet in oven and bake for 20 minutes.
- While patties are baking add gravy mix to water in a pot on the stove and stirring occasionally let thicken.
- *Here's the key; turkey is low fat and so is the gravy mix.
- Prepare mashed potatoes and green beans or any other side dish you prefer.
